Stephen Fry in support of Extinction Rebellion: Something has to be done
National treasure, actor and comedian Stephen Fry called on the British public to support Extinction Rebellion. Speaking to camera Fry, said: Reasonable people, I think, understand that something has to be done about fossil fuels, most of all about our insatiable appetite for them. Its not good just saying everybody give up carbon use because we cant ultimately its up to governments. You need to get them to recognise that this is the most serious crisis that humanity has ever faced and that therefore we should plan, we should plan in a friendly way, in a way that involves all of humanity. Disruption can be an awful thing. It can ruin the way the world is. But there s another form of disruption, which is to stop the world going down the wrong path. To disrupt a destructive journey. And that s what Extinction Rebellion, for example, does. Frys comments come as record breaking temperatures sweep across Europe increasing the risk of extensive forest fires this summer
